Busch, Columbus, OH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Busch?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Busch Studio Apartments | $1,065 | $729 | $2,586 |
| Busch 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,199 | $650 | $2,070 |
| Busch 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,425 | $695 | $2,805 |
| Busch 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,807 | $975 | $4,419 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Busch?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,459 | $1,095 | $2,300 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$2,190 | $1,600 | $2,799 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$3,331 | $3,000 | $3,695 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$2,100 | $2,100 | $2,100 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Busch
What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in the Busch area of Columbus, OH?
As of today, August 28, 2026, there are currently 243 available Busch apartments priced from $650 to $4,419, with an average monthly rent of $1,357.
How much are Studio apartments in Busch?
There are currently 67 Studio Apartments in Busch with rent ranges from $729 to $2,586 with an average price of $1,065.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Busch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Busch ranges from $650 to $2,070 with an average monthly rent of $1,199.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Busch c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Busch range from $695 to $2,805.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,425.
How expensive are Busch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Busch on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$975 to $4,419 - averaging $1,807 for the location.
